Breakthru Center/NAWBO Present NAWBO Means Business
March 24, 2011, Albuquerque, UNM Campus - Barbara Kline, Founder and President of Breakthru Communications presented a discussion for entrepreneurs and members of University of New Mexico (UNM)’s technology faculty supporting organization, STC. Her topic covered a concept called “Four Pillars” upon which successful startups are based: passion, leadership, adequate funding and technical savvy.
